I want to cancel my eetv. I can't find out how to do it. It costs me a lot of money each month for something I don't need anymore as I have bought a Freely Tv
24-04-2026 02:04 PM
To cancel your EE TV you phone EE on the Freephone no. (Opt 1) in my sig. and give 30 days notice. If you are still within your min term you will be liable to pay Early Termination Fees for the rest of the term.
